What's New: October 2022

October 27, 2022

The October update of the American National Biography features four new essays, including baseball Hall of Famer Hank Aaron; Louise Dickinson Rich, writer of the best-selling 1942 memoir We Took to the Woods; Alfred Cowles, who shaped the modern study of economics; and Indiana industrialist and philanthropist J. Miller Irwin.

Aaron, Hank (5 Feb. 1934–22 Jan. 2021), baseball player

Cowles, Alfred (15 Sept. 1891–28 Dec. 1984),businessman and economist

Miller, J. Irwin (26 May 1909–19 Aug. 2004), industrialist and philanthropist

Rich, Louise Dickinson (14 June 1903–9 Apr. 1991), writer
